From leftovers to curtains

LENDA curtains have been part of our range for around 20 years, much appreciated for the soft atmosphere they bring to the room and the gentle way light filters through their cotton fabric. Now, there are even more reasons to like them – starting with the new light pink version.

”It’s not something you’d notice when hanging your curtains, but together with our supplier, we’ve managed to create a fabric made from 50% leftover cotton from the textile industry,” says an enthusiastic Karin Svensson, one of our textile engineers.

Leftovers are spun into new yarn

In almost all textile production, leftover yarn and fabric scraps are common. For a long time, they’ve often been discarded because they weren’t seen as the resource they really are. “We know cotton production uses a lot of water and chemicals. So, when leftover textiles get thrown away, it’s a huge waste of resources,” Karin says. Just like we did, our supplier saw the value in saving those scraps and developed a method where textiles are shredded into fibres that can be spun into new yarn. A certain amount of unbleached cotton fibres must be added to achieve the right yarn strength. “To get this light pink tone for LENDA, the supplier used textile leftovers in selected colours. But because the raw materials are different, the colour can shift slightly as a nice reminder of where the fabric comes from.”

Recycling starts with the right choices

The LENDA project is an important step toward our goal of using only renewable or recycled materials in our products. Now, we're working on introducing recycled fabric in more colours. Through her work, Karin has seen just how complex the traditional textile industry can be. “Different materials and colors are often mixed, which makes recycling difficult. With LENDA, we've learned that we have to think about sustainability right from the start – and find creative solutions with whatever conditions we're working with."

The fabric dims the daylight

The fabric dims the daylight entering the room when it is brighter outside, and reduces glare. It gives you a comfortable sense of privacy because people cannot see in during the daytime. At night, when the room is lit, it is possible to perceive shapes and silhouettes from outside.
